13-Day Adventure-packed Trip through Lahaul, Sissu, Manali, Kasol, Kheerganga Trek,Tosh,Parvathy Valley, Tirthan Valley and Bir!

  • Day 1: Arrive in Manali and explore the town
    0 minutes (0 miles) from Manali airport

    Check into your hotel, freshen up and start exploring this beautiful town nestled in the Himalayas. Take a walk, visit some art galleries and indulge in some street shopping. End the day with local street food and local beer.

  • Day 2: Trek to Jogini Waterfall and Solang Valley
    30 minutes (8.6 miles) from Manali

    Start the day early with a trek to Jogini Waterfall, one of the most beautiful waterfalls near Manali. Then visit Solang Valley which offers adventure sports like skiing, paragliding, and zorbing.

  • Day 3: Drive to Lahaul & Sissu
    4 hours (124.4 km) from Manali

    Start the day with a scenic drive to Lahaul. Stop at Sissu to take in the spectacular views of the towering Himalayan mountains and the Chandra river. Don't forget to take some creative pictures.

  • Day 4: Explore the Kunzum Pass and Chandratal Lake
    5 hours (97 km) from Sissu

    Go on a day trip to Kunzum Pass, one of the highest motorable mountain passes in India, offering panoramic views of the Himalayas. Then trek to Chandratal Lake, which is popular for its crystal clear blue waters and divine surroundings. Enjoy a picturesque sunset.

  • Day 5: Drive to Kasol
    9 hours (215 km) from Lahaul

    Start your journey early to reach Kasol in time. This charming hamlet is a favorite among backpackers and has numerous cafes and serene spots to relax around. Go for late-night stargazing.

  • Day 6: Trek to the Kheerganga
    22 minutes (5 km) from Kasol

    Embark on a beautiful trek to the Kheerganga, famous for its hot water springs that are said to have medicinal properties. At the top, enjoy a stunning view of the Himalayas from the natural hot water spring.

  • Day 7: Drive to Tosh
    1 hour 30 minutes (35 km) from Kasol

    Drive to the peaceful village of Tosh nestled in the Parvati Valley. This is the ultimate place to unwind with the sound of nature and the scenic views.

  • Day 8: Trek to Parvathy Valley
    3 hours from Tosh

    Embark on a beautiful trek to the Parvathy Valley, which is situated at a staggering altitude of 10,000 feet. Take in the stunning views of the landscape and spend an overnight in tents.

  • Day 9: Explore the tranquil Tirthan Valley
    4 hours (144 km) from Parvathy Valley

    The Tirthan Valley is a serene spot where you can immerse yourself in nature. Visit the Great Himalayan National Park and trek to the Gushaini waterfall. At night, spend your time stargazing with a bonfire.

  • Day 10: Witness the Paragliders in Bir
    6 hours (200 km) from Tirthan Valley

    Drive to Bir, popular for its paragliding activities. Witness hundreds of paragliders soaring through the air and feel the adrenaline rush. Take a stroll across the Bir Tibetan Colony to explore local handicrafts.

  • Day 11-13: Return to Manali and Departure
    1 hour 40 minutes (65 km) from Bir

    Drive back to Manali and spend your last few days relaxing and revisiting your favorite spots. On the final day, check out of your hotel and depart for the airport.

Transportation

For traveling to most of the destinations, we will be using taxis or rented cars. Make sure to understand the road rules and weather conditions before renting a car. It is recommended to keep extra time in hand in case of weather-related roadblocks. Air travel is not a feasible option for most of the destinations.

Useful Tips

If you have more than 13 days, you can add a trip to the Rohtang Pass, which is known for its scenic beauty. You can visit Manikaran for its hot water spring and visit the historic Naggar Castle. If you have a tight schedule, you can skip Kheerganga Trek and jump directly to Tosh.

Airports

The nearest airport to Manali is the Bhuntar Airport (KUU), located 49 km from the city center. The airport is well-connected to major cities in India like Delhi, Mumbai, and Chandigarh. From the airport, you can hire a taxi to reach Manali.
